A THREE PIECE GROUP OF 19TH CENTURY SILVER AND CRYSTAL DRESSER PIECES. Comprising a George Boin and Emile Taburet (after 1838) silver dresser tray, and a pair of crystal dresser boxes, possibly by Baccarat with spiral ribbed pattern and with .950 silver repousse lids with indistinguishable makerās marks. The tray 13.5 inches x 10.75 inches (34 x 27 cm). Total weight 29.06 troy oz.
